Default Help Please

We have just bought a rover 75 diesel auto tourer. Great car,great drive very happy!! All of a sudden she developed starting problems,sometime starts on first pull, sometimes though she struggles and sometimes starts and then dies. Getting through diesel like nobodys' business, in at the garage at the mo. changed one fuel pump still suffering starting problems (from cold or warm makes no difference). Garage is stumped and suggest changing another fuel pump!! Also told I had a problem with my 'air math meter' ?? Does anyone know what this does?! It has been changed twice and still registers a fault on the diagnostic computer. Am told it is not within range all the time.
Can anyone help with any ideas??
Thank you
Ape 195

P.S. She is a 2001 model,
